  • Onimusha Blade Warriors, known as Onimusha Buraiden (鬼武者 無頼伝 Onimusha Buraiden?) in Japan, is a PlayStation 2 fighting game from Capcom's Onimusha series. MegaMan.EXE and Zero (as he appears in the Mega Man Zero series) are hidden playable characters in this game. The two are bright, colorful anime characters in contrast to the game's dim, colorless, realistic sets and characters. Each character has three playable forms, which are: MegaMan.EXE, MegaMan.EXE Ground Style, MegaMan.EXE Bug Style, Zero, Zero's Proto Form, and Zero's Ultimate Form. This game is rated T by the ESRB.
  • The story takes place months after the events in Onimusha 2: Samurai's Destiny and 11 years before the events in Onimusha 3: Demon Siege. During the events of Blade Warriors, Samanosuke and Kaede team up with Jubei and some of his teammates.
